Joshimath: Authorities at Joshimath mentioned on Tuesday that they are going to begin demolishing inns and homes within the holy city, which developed cracks within the wake of the landslide and subsidence.
Inns Malari Inn and Mount View, which have developed extra cracks, might be demolished on Tuesday, officers mentioned, including that every one residents have been safely evacuated from the ‘unsafe zones’.
The demolition of buildings will start beneath the supervision of a workforce of consultants from the Central Constructing Analysis Institute (CBRI), Roorkee.
A workforce from the Nationwide Catastrophe Response Pressure (NDRF) is on standby to help the district administration within the demolition work, as and when required.
“Consultants are on the bottom and the administration will take motion on their instructions and recommendation,” mentioned the NDRF.
“They are going to be demolishing these inns for the security of the 15-20 households nonetheless residing right here. Our homes have been destroyed,” mentioned Manmohan Singh Rawat, an area.
On Monday, District Justice of the Peace Himanshu Khurana knowledgeable {that a} central workforce was to reach in Chamoli district to survey the injury wrought to properties by the land subsidence and recommend a approach ahead whereas coordinating with the native administration in reduction and rescue efforts.
“A workforce from the Ministry of House Affairs will come to Joshimath on Tuesday. Demolition of buildings will begin tomorrow beneath the supervision of the workforce of Central Constructing Analysis Institute (CBRI) Roorkee,” Khurana had mentioned earlier.
On Monday, a workforce from the Ministry of Jal Shakti additionally arrived at Joshimath.
The areas the place the buildings might be demolished have been vacated by the administration after they had been declared ‘unsafe zones’.
The officers of the Nationwide Catastrophe Administration Authority (NDMA) additionally referred to as on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ami at his residence on Monday and mentioned reduction and rescue operations.
The officers assured the chief minister of an investigation into the geographical situation of the Joshimath space and the causes of the landslide. The state administration was additionally assured of central in mobilising catastrophe reduction.
In the meantime, the District Catastrophe Administration Authority, Chamoli issued a bulletin associated to catastrophe administration in view of landslides within the Joshimath space.
Based on the bulletin, cracks have been observed in a complete of 678 buildings within the Joshimath city space. In view of safety, a complete of 81 households have been quickly displaced.
“Beneath Joshimath metropolis space, 213 rooms have been quickly recognized as liveable, with their capacities estimated at 1191. Additionally, 491 rooms/halls have been recognized in Pipalkoti exterior Joshimath space, with a mixed capability of two,205,” the bulletin mentioned.
The administration has additionally distributed meals kits and blankets to the affected households, as per their necessities together with the distribution of funds to obtain important home items.
A complete of 63 meals kits and 53 blankets have been made accessible for the affected locals.
